Banksy Sneak Peak

We stumbled upon some images of Banksy’s work at Steve Lazaride’s (Banksy’s manager) office and future gallery space at Point Blank’s blog on Honeyee. With Bansky’s recent antics with the whole Paris Hilton and Disneyland incidents, Banksy has easily become a popular faceless figure in the art community. Since we don’t get to meet the man himself, at least we have some more images of some of the things he’s done and is working on. Until then, this is the best we have. Nike Doernbecher Dunk Lows

Nike Doernbecher Dunk Lows

Last week, Niketown released these Doernbecher Dunk Lows as a charity related drop for Charity OHSU – Children’s Hospital Foundation. The sneakers feature laser engraving of hand drawn designs within the textured leather of the shoes. The kicks were designed by Lance Dillon, a 17 yr. old LaPine High School senior, who came to Doernbecher with acute lymphoblastic leukemia. Only 1050 pairs of the kicks were made. Muji International Design Competition Winner

Muji International Design Competition Winner

The Muji Award International Design Competition was recently held and the winner is Yoh Komiyama of Japan. The winner designed a “cast of skin.” It’s an outlet plug designed to do three things; 1. To Save Energy 2. To prevent dust or waste from penetrating an outlet, and 3. To maintain a connection between an outlet plug and an outlet. It was a simple design concept, but it was both innovative and environmentally friendly. Congrats to Yoh Komiyama. Image/Info: Bare Blog
